Mastering the Art of Cooking the Perfect Medium-Well Steak

Achieving a perfectly cooked medium-well steak requires a combination of proper preparation, precise timing, and attentive monitoring. The journey to a juicy, flavorful steak begins with selecting the right cut and preparing it correctly. Start by choosing a high-quality piece of meat and bringing it to room temperature. This step ensures the steak cooks evenly by preventing the exterior from overcooking before the interior reaches the desired temperature. According to culinary experts, seasoning generously with salt and pepper or your preferred spices enhances flavor and creates a delicious crust. Preheating your skillet or grill to a high temperature is essential for searing the steak properly, which seals in juices and flavor. Sear each side for about 4 to 5 minutes until a rich, brown crust forms, providing an attractive appearance and locking in moisture. A meat thermometer is indispensable at this stage; monitor the internal temperature and aim for approximately 150°F (65°C) to achieve medium-well doneness. After searing, reduce the heat and continue cooking until the steak reaches the right internal temperature. Once cooked, it’s crucial to let the steak rest for at least five minutes. Cooking Times and Techniques for Your Steak

Cooking times significantly influence the outcome of your steak, varying based on method and thickness. Grill a one-inch thick steak for approximately 4 to 5 minutes per side to achieve medium rare. For thicker cuts, such as a 2-inch steak, plan for around 8 to 10 minutes per side to attain the desired doneness. Pan-searing typically takes about 3 to 4 minutes per side for a one-inch thickness, creating a flavorful crust while maintaining internal juiciness. Broiling is another effective method, with durations around 4 to 6 minutes per side for medium rare, depending on thickness. Using a reliable meat thermometer during cooking ensures maximum accuracy; medium rare is reached at 130 to 135°F, whereas well-done is at 160°F or higher. Techniques to Check Doneness Like a Professional

Estimating steak doneness involves traditional methods alongside modern tools. The finger test is popular among chefs, where pressing the steak with your finger helps gauge firmness. To simulate rare steak, connect your thumb to your index finger and press the flesh below your thumb. For medium-well doneness, connect your thumb with your middle finger, which increases firmness. Although helpful, this technique can be subjective and varies between individuals. For the most accurate results, use a meat thermometer inserted into the thickest part of the steak. An internal reading of about 150 to 155°F (65 to 68°C) indicates medium-well. Regularly checking temperature removes guesswork and ensures consistent results. Impact of Thickness and Cut on Cooking Times

The size and cut of your steak play vital roles in determining cooking duration. Thicker cuts generally need more time to reach the desired temperature, especially for medium rare stages. For example, a one-inch thick steak typically takes 4 to 6 minutes per side, whereas a thinner half-inch steak may require only 2 to 3 minutes. Different cuts also vary in tenderness and cooking preferences. Tender cuts like filet mignon cook faster and benefit from shorter, high-heat methods. Tougher cuts such as chuck or brisket demand longer, slow cooking to tenderize the meat and enhance flavor. Adjusting cooking durations based on cut and thickness ensures the steak’s quality remains intact. Using a meat thermometer allows precise monitoring, aligning with USDA safety standards. Maintaining Food Safety Without Compromising Juiciness

Food safety is paramount when cooking meats like steak. Achieving the right internal temperature eliminates harmful pathogens and ensures safe consumption. For beef steaks, the USDA suggests cooking to at least 145°F (63°C) followed by a rest period. Chicken, however, must reach 165°F (74°C) to be safe. Using a food thermometer is the most reliable method to monitor internal temperatures accurately. Resting the meat after cooking allows juices to flow back into the muscle fibers, enhancing flavor and moisture. Techniques such as sous-vide cooking help maintain moisture while achieving precise control over temperature, ensuring safety and culinary excellence.
